AJR 10, a resolution urging Congress and the president to maintain support for the U.S. Forest Service and its work in California, was moved out of committee after members highlighted federal share of forestlands and wildfire and watershed impacts.

Assemblymember Rogers presented AJR 10, a joint resolution calling on the president and Congress to maintain or restore funding and support for the U.S. Forest Service, noting that 57% of California forestland is federally administered and that federal stewardship affects fire risk, watersheds and local economies.
